How Local Experts Tackle Wasp Infestations
Once connected with a local exterminator through Heat N Go Pest Control, you can expect a thorough and professional process. Wasp removal services typically involve several key steps:
- Inspection: The exterminator will first conduct a detailed inspection of your property to identify all active wasp nests, assess the type of wasp species present, and determine the extent of the infestation. This often includes checking eaves, attics, sheds, garages, and even underground areas for nests.
- Treatment Plan: Based on the inspection, a tailored treatment plan will be developed. This plan will consider the severity of the infestation, the location of the nests, and the proximity to people and pets.
- Nest Elimination: Professionals utilize a range of effective methods to eliminate nests. This can include:
- Dusts and Powders: Often applied directly into nest openings, these treatments are carried back into the nest by the wasps, killing the colony.
- Sprays and Aerosols: Fast-acting sprays are used to incapacitate and kill wasps on contact, often applied at dawn or dusk when wasps are less active.
- Wasp Traps: Strategically placed traps can help reduce the adult wasp population around your property.
- Physical Removal: In some cases, especially for accessible aerial nests, trained professionals may physically remove the nest structure after treatment.
- Preventative Measures: After eliminating the current threat, your local expert may recommend preventative measures to deter future wasp activity. This could include sealing entry points in your home or advising on landscaping choices that are less attractive to wasps.

Common Wasp Species and Treatments in Longwood NY
Longwood, New York, like much of Long Island, is susceptible to various wasp species. Common culprits include:
- Yellow Jackets: These aggressive wasps often build nests underground or in wall voids. Their social nature means a disturbed nest can result in a swarm of angry insects.
- Paper Wasps: Easily identified by their umbrella-shaped nests, often found under eaves, in attics, or on porch ceilings. While generally less aggressive than yellow jackets, they will still sting if their nest is threatened.
- Hornets: Including the European Hornet and potentially the invasive Asian Giant Hornet (though less common but still a concern), these build large, papery nests typically in trees, on buildings, or in sheltered cavities.
The methods employed by local exterminators are adapted to these species. For underground nests, specialized insecticides are injected into the entrance. For aerial nests, powerful sprays are often used, applied from a safe distance. Frequently Asked Questions About Wasp Extermination in Longwood
Q1: How long does a typical wasp extermination service take in Longwood?
A: The duration of a wasp extermination service in Longwood can vary depending on the size and accessibility of the nest, as well as the species of wasp involved. A simple nest removal might take less than an hour, while larger or more complex infestations, particularly those in difficult-to-reach areas like wall voids or underground, may require multiple visits or longer treatment times. Often, the initial extermination and nest removal can be completed within a single appointment.
Q2: Are there specific times of year when wasp problems are worse in Longwood, and when should I call an exterminator?
A: Wasp activity typically increases significantly during the warmer months, from late spring through early autumn, as their colonies grow. You should call an exterminator in Longwood as soon as you notice any signs of wasp nests on your property, such as increased wasp activity around a specific area or the construction of visible nests. Early intervention is always more effective and less risky than waiting for a large, established colony.
